Starting my first all grain batch today any last minute advice?
 
I'm a newbie, but from my first two all grain batches, all I can say is be prepared. Make sure you have your sparge water ready to go, and make sure you have your cooling method ready to go. Those are the two things that stress me out on brew day for some reason!! Good luck and happy brewing!!
